本發明涉及信息處理技術領域,尤其涉及一種移動終端的信息自動歸類方法和系統。
背景技術:
隨著科技的發展和社會的進步,智能手機逐步開始普及,移動智能生活已經開始改變人們的生活習慣。智能手機會收到各種各樣的信息,大量信息會存儲在混合放在一起,無法分開并分類,信息隨著時間推移越來越多,不但不便于瀏覽,也給手機內存帶來一定的使用壓力,為了更方便用戶的需求,提出一種基于移動終端的信息自動歸類方法。
目前已經有對信息的各種處理,包括對信息的安全加密,信息的過濾攔截,對于信息的歸類處理,目前有人提出的方案有如:小米的信息黃頁,致力于消滅陌生來電號碼。雖然有眾多的方便用戶對不同行業不同人的電話號碼的歸整理,可以方便選擇各種編撰好的信息,有各種方便,唯獨對于得到海量的信息之后,雜亂無章的信息無法進行方便的查閱,需要逐條或者記憶去查找。
因此,如何將移動終端收到的信息,進行歸類和管理,成為本領域亟需解決的問題。
技術實現要素:
本發明的目的是提供一種更加方便將移動終端收到的信息進行歸類和管理的移動終端的信息自動歸類方法和系統。
本發明的目的是通過以下技術方案來實現的:
一種移動終端的信息自動歸類方法,包括:
獲取移動終端接收到的信息;
獲取所述信息的分類屬性,所述分類屬性至少包括通訊方的姓名和號碼、信息內容、通訊方所屬行業或企業、通訊方的信息數量;
根據分類屬性將所述信息進行相應的分類,并對不同的分類進行標記;
根據用戶的指令顯示相應分類的信息。
優選的,所述根據分類屬性將所述信息進行相應的分類的步驟具體包括:
根據通訊方是否已錄入到移動終端的通訊錄中進行分類;
根據所述通訊方所屬行業或企業進行分類;
根據所述信息內容中是否存在預設字符串進行分類;
根據接收到的通訊方的信息數量進行分類。
優選的,所述根據通訊方是否已錄入到移動終端的通訊錄中進行分類的步驟之后還包括:若通訊方已錄入到移動終端的通訊錄中,則根據通訊方的姓名中的首字母進行分類。
優選的,所述根據通訊方是否已錄入到移動終端的通訊錄中進行分類的步驟之后還包括:根據移動終端接收到信息的時間進行排序;
所述根據所述通訊方所屬行業或企業進行分類的步驟之后還包括:根據移動終端接收到信息的時間進行排序;
所述根據所述信息中是否存在預設字符串進行分類的步驟之后還包括:根據移動終端接收到信息的時間進行排序。
優選的,所述根據接收到的通訊方的信息數量進行分類的步驟之后還包括:根據通訊方的信息數量進行排序,若通訊方的信息數量相同,則按照通訊方的姓名中的首字母進行排序。
本發明公開一種移動終端的信息自動歸類系統,包括:
信息獲取模塊,用于獲取移動終端接收到的信息;
分類屬性提取模塊,用于獲取所述信息的分類屬性,所述分類屬性至少包括通訊方的姓名和號碼、信息內容、通訊方所屬行業或企業、通訊方的信息數量;
信息分類模塊,用于根據分類屬性將所述信息進行相應的分類,并對不同的分類進行標記;
分類顯示模塊,用于根據用戶的指令顯示相應分類的信息。
優選的,所述信息分類模塊包括:
通訊錄分類單元,用于根據通訊方是否已錄入到移動終端的通訊錄中進行分類;
通訊源分類單元,用于根據所述通訊方所屬行業或企業進行分類;
字符串分類單元,用于根據所述信息內容中是否存在預設字符串進行分類;
姓名分類單元,用于根據所述通訊方的姓名中的首字母進行分類;
信息數量分類單元,用于根據接收到的通訊方的信息數量進行分類。
優選的,所述通訊錄分類單元還用于:若通訊方已錄入到移動終端的通訊錄中,則根據通訊方的姓名中的首字母進行分類。
優選的,所述通訊錄分類單元還用于:根據移動終端接收到信息的時間進行排序;
所述通訊源分類單元還用于:根據移動終端接收到信息的時間進行排序;
所述字符串分類單元還用于:根據移動終端接收到信息的時間進行排序。
優選的,所述信息數量分類單元還用于:根據通訊方的信息數量進行排序,若通訊方的信息數量相同,則按照通訊方的姓名中的首字母進行排序。
本發明的移動終端的信息自動歸類方法由于包括:獲取移動終端接收到的信息;獲取所述信息的分類屬性,所述分類屬性至少包括通訊方的姓名和號碼、信息內容、通訊方所屬行業或企業、通訊方的信息數量;根據分類屬性將所述信息進行相應的分類,并對不同的分類進行標記;根據用戶的指令顯示相應分類的信息。這樣就可以同時根據不同的分類屬性將信息進行分類,并且以相應的分類進行標記,這樣就可以得到多種分類結果。采用本發明這種方式可以更加方便將移動終端收到的信息進行歸類和管理的,用戶就可以根據自己的篩選自己想要的分類結果,移動終端就會根據用戶的指令將相應的分類結果顯示出來,以供用戶查看,這樣就可以極大的方便了用戶分類別查看信息,極大的方便了用戶篩選自己想要的信息,在當今信息量巨大的情況下,大大的提高了用戶篩選信息的效率。
附圖說明
圖1是本發明實施例一的移動終端的信息自動歸類方法的流程圖;
圖2是本發明實施例二的移動終端的信息自動歸類系統的示意圖。
具體實施方式
雖然流程圖將各項操作描述成順序的處理,但是其中的許多操作可以被并行地、并發地或者同時實施。各項操作的順序可以被重新安排。當其操作完成時處理可以被終止,但是還可以具有未包括在附圖中的附加步驟。處理可以對應于方法、函數、規程、子例程、子程序等等。
計算機設備包括用戶設備與網絡設備。其中,用戶設備或客戶端包括但不限于電腦、智能手機、PDA等;網絡設備包括但不限于單個網絡服務器、多個網絡服務器組成的服務器組或基于云計算的由大量計算機或網絡服務器構成的云。計算機設備可單獨運行來實現本發明,也可接入網絡并通過與網絡中的其他計算機設備的交互操作來實現本發明。計算機設備所處的網絡包括但不限于互聯網、廣域網、城域網、局域網、VPN網絡等。
在這里可能使用了術語“第一”、“第二”等等來描述各個單元,但是這些單元不應當受這些術語限制,使用這些術語僅僅是為了將一個單元與另一個單元進行區分。這里所使用的術語“和/或”包括其中一個或更多所列出的相關聯項目的任意和所有組合。當一個單元被稱為“連接”或“耦合”到另一單元時,其可以直接連接或耦合到所述另一單元,或者可以存在中間單元。
這里所使用的術語僅僅是為了描述具體實施例而不意圖限制示例性實施例。除非上下文明確地另有所指,否則這里所使用的單數形式“一個”、“一項”還意圖包括復數。還應當理解的是,這里所使用的術語“包括”和/或“包含”規定所陳述的特征、整數、步驟、操作、單元和/或組件的存在,而不排除存在或添加一個或更多其他特征、整數、步驟、操作、單元、組件和/或其組合。
下面結合附圖和較佳的實施例對本發明作進一步說明。
實施例一
如圖1所示,本實施例中公開一種移動終端的信息自動歸類方法,包括:
S101、獲取移動終端接收到的信息;
S102、獲取所述信息的分類屬性,所述分類屬性至少包括通訊方的姓名和號碼、信息內容、通訊方所屬行業或企業、通訊方的信息數量;
S103、根據分類屬性將所述信息進行相應的分類,并對不同的分類進行標記;
S104、根據用戶的指令顯示相應分類的信息。
本發明的移動終端的信息自動歸類方法由于包括:獲取移動終端接收到的信息;獲取所述信息的分類屬性,所述分類屬性至少包括通訊方的姓名和號碼、信息內容、通訊方所屬行業或企業、通訊方的信息數量;根據分類屬性將所述信息進行相應的分類,并對不同的分類進行標記;根據用戶的指令顯示相應分類的信息。這樣就可以同時根據不同的分類屬性將信息進行分類,并且以相應的分類進行標記,這樣就可以得到多種分類結果。采用本發明這種方式可以更加方便將移動終端收到的信息進行歸類和管理的,用戶就可以根據自己的篩選自己想要的分類結果,移動終端就會根據用戶的指令將相應的分類結果顯示出來,以供用戶查看,這樣就可以極大的方便了用戶分類別查看信息,極大的方便了用戶篩選自己想要的信息,在當今信息量巨大的情況下,大大的提高了用戶篩選信息的效率。
本實施例中,在獲取移動終端接收到的信息之前,移動終端會通過云端獲取到現在各大銀行、學校、知名企業、移動公司、聯通公司、電信公司等運營商、各個政府部門的電話進行采集,建立數據庫,以方便分類。當然也會采集移動終端通訊錄中的姓名、電話、郵箱、地址等信息。
根據其中一個示例,所述根據分類屬性將所述信息進行相應的分類的步驟具體包括:
根據通訊方是否已錄入到移動終端的通訊錄中進行分類;
根據所述通訊方所屬行業或企業進行分類;
根據所述信息內容中是否存在預設字符串進行分類;
根據接收到的通訊方的信息數量進行分類。
采用上述方式,就可以根據分類屬性將信息進行同時分類,根據不同的分類屬性將信息在每個分類屬性下都進行分類。例如,根據通訊方是否已錄入到移動終端的通訊錄中,將信息分為通訊錄號碼和陌生人號碼,這樣就可以減少用戶篩選信息的時間,加快篩選信息的效率。又如,還可以根據通訊方的電話在數據庫中查看是否屬于某個行業或企業或單位等的聯系方式,從而根據行業或企業的電話進行分類,例如發信人的電話號碼是10086,那么根據數據庫中查詢到是移動公司的,那么就會分類到移動公司的名錄下,同樣,其余如1008611、1008612等號碼發送的信息也會同樣分類到移動公司的名錄下,這樣用戶在查看移動公司的名錄時就會查看到屬于移動公司的電話的所有信息,方便了用戶的使用。又如,還可以預先設定字符串,如“余額不足”,那么對于信息內容中包含有“余額不足”的信息,就會分類到包含有“余額不足”的分類下,分類的名稱可以默認設置為預設的字符串,例如就設置為余額不足的分類名稱,這樣就可以方便用戶查看包含這類字符串的信息,當用戶收到包含有余額不足的信息時,用戶就會更快、更準確的了解到自己話費的狀況,及時繳費,避免停機。又如,還可以根據接收到的通訊方的信息數量進行分類,例如,收到10086的信息為90條,收到張三的信息為50條,收到李四的信息為80條,那么就會根據收到信息的條數的多少進行排序,方便用戶查看常用聯系人的信息。
用戶在使用時,例如可以選擇通訊錄分類,那么就會篩選出根據銅須路分類的結果,篩選出根據通訊方是否已錄入到移動終端的通訊錄中分類出的信息;如果用戶選擇通訊源分類,那么就會篩選出根據發件人的企業或單位等篩選出的信息;如果用戶選擇字符串分類,那么就會篩選出含有預設的字符串的信息和不含有預設的字符串的信息的分類;如果用戶選擇信息數量分類,那么就會篩選出根據不同的信息數量的分類。本實施例中,上述分類是同時進行的,在獲取到信息后,在每個類別都要進行分類,這樣才方便用戶查找信息。
根據其中另一個示例,所述根據通訊方是否已錄入到移動終端的通訊錄中進行分類的步驟之后還包括:若通訊方已錄入到移動終端的通訊錄中,則根據通訊方的姓名中的首字母進行分類。
這樣就可以方便用戶查看通訊方,一般都是根據英語字母表中的順序進行排序。例如,收到張三的信息,也收到李四的信息為,由于字母L在字母表中排序在字母Z的前面,所以李四的信息就會排在前面,如果首字母相同,可以以名字的第二個字母排列,依次類推。
根據其中另一個示例,所述根據通訊方是否已錄入到移動終端的通訊錄中進行分類的步驟之后還包括:根據移動終端接收到信息的時間進行排序;
所述根據所述通訊方所屬行業或企業進行分類的步驟之后還包括:根據移動終端接收到信息的時間進行排序;
所述根據所述信息中是否存在預設字符串進行分類的步驟之后還包括:根據移動終端接收到信息的時間進行排序。
這樣就可以讓用戶了解到最新的信息,也方便用戶查到需要了解的信息。
根據其中另一個示例,所述根據接收到的通訊方的信息數量進行分類的步驟之后還包括:根據通訊方的信息數量進行排序,若通訊方的信息數量相同,則按照通訊方的姓名中的首字母進行排序。
這樣就更加方便用戶查找信息。例如,收到張三的信息為50條,收到李四的信息為80條,收到王五的信息為50條,那么首先就會根據收到信息的條數的多少進行排序,李四拍在第一位,但是由于收到張三和王五的信息數量相同,那么就應該根據張三和王五的首字母順序進行排列,一般都是根據英語字母表中的順序進行排序,這時由于字母W在字母Z的前面,因此王五的信息就會排在張三的前面顯示,這樣也符合用戶的使用習慣,方便用戶使用。
實施例二
如圖2所示,本實施例中公開一種移動終端的信息自動歸類系統,包括:
信息獲取模塊201,用于獲取移動終端接收到的信息;
分類屬性提取模塊202,用于獲取所述信息的分類屬性,所述分類屬性至少包括通訊方的姓名和號碼、信息內容、通訊方所屬行業或企業、通訊方的信息數量;
信息分類模塊203,用于根據分類屬性將所述信息進行相應的分類,并對不同的分類進行標記;
分類顯示模塊204,用于根據用戶的指令顯示相應分類的信息。
這樣就可以同時根據不同的分類屬性將信息進行分類,并且以相應的分類進行標記,這樣就可以得到多種分類結果。采用本發明這種方式可以更加方便將移動終端收到的信息進行歸類和管理的,用戶就可以根據自己的篩選自己想要的分類結果,移動終端就會根據用戶的指令將相應的分類結果顯示出來,以供用戶查看,這樣就可以極大的方便了用戶分類別查看信息,極大的方便了用戶篩選自己想要的信息,在當今信息量巨大的情況下,大大的提高了用戶篩選信息的效率。
本實施例中,在獲取移動終端接收到的信息之前,移動終端會通過云端獲取到現在各大銀行、學校、知名企業、移動公司、聯通公司、電信公司等運營商、各個政府部門的電話進行采集,建立數據庫,以方便分類。當然也會采集移動終端通訊錄中的姓名、電話、郵箱、地址等信息。
根據其中一個示例,所述信息分類模塊包括:
通訊錄分類單元,用于根據通訊方是否已錄入到移動終端的通訊錄中進行分類;
通訊源分類單元,用于根據所述通訊方所屬行業或企業進行分類;
字符串分類單元,用于根據所述信息內容中是否存在預設字符串進行分類;
姓名分類單元,用于根據所述通訊方的姓名中的首字母進行分類;
信息數量分類單元,用于根據接收到的通訊方的信息數量進行分類。
采用上述方式,就可以根據分類屬性將信息進行同時分類,根據不同的分類屬性將信息在每個分類屬性下都進行分類。例如,根據通訊方是否已錄入到移動終端的通訊錄中,將信息分為通訊錄號碼和陌生人號碼,這樣就可以減少用戶篩選信息的時間,加快篩選信息的效率。又如,還可以根據通訊方的電話在數據庫中查看是否屬于某個行業或企業或單位等的聯系方式,從而根據行業或企業的電話進行分類,例如發信人的電話號碼是10086,那么根據數據庫中查詢到是移動公司的,那么就會分類到移動公司的名錄下,同樣,其余如1008611、1008612等號碼發送的信息也會同樣分類到移動公司的名錄下,這樣用戶在查看移動公司的名錄時就會查看到屬于移動公司的電話的所有信息,方便了用戶的使用。又如,還可以預先設定字符串,如“余額不足”,那么對于信息內容中包含有“余額不足”的信息,就會分類到包含有“余額不足”的分類下,分類的名稱可以默認設置為預設的字符串,例如就設置為余額不足的分類名稱,這樣就可以方便用戶查看包含這類字符串的信息,當用戶收到包含有余額不足的信息時,用戶就會更快、更準確的了解到自己話費的狀況,及時繳費,避免停機。又如,還可以根據接收到的通訊方的信息數量進行分類,例如,收到10086的信息為90條,收到張三的信息為50條,收到李四的信息為80條,那么就會根據收到信息的條數的多少進行排序,方便用戶查看常用聯系人的信息。
用戶在使用時,例如可以選擇通訊錄分類,那么就會篩選出根據銅須路分類的結果,篩選出根據通訊方是否已錄入到移動終端的通訊錄中分類出的信息;如果用戶選擇通訊源分類,那么就會篩選出根據發件人的企業或單位等篩選出的信息;如果用戶選擇字符串分類,那么就會篩選出含有預設的字符串的信息和不含有預設的字符串的信息的分類;如果用戶選擇信息數量分類,那么就會篩選出根據不同的信息數量的分類。本實施例中,上述分類是同時進行的,在獲取到信息后,在每個類別都要進行分類,這樣才方便用戶查找信息。
根據其中另一個示例,所述通訊錄分類單元還用于:若通訊方已錄入到移動終端的通訊錄中,則根據通訊方的姓名中的首字母進行分類。
這樣就可以方便用戶查看通訊方,一般都是根據英語字母表中的順序進行排序。例如,收到張三的信息,也收到李四的信息為,由于字母L在字母表中排序在字母Z的前面,所以李四的信息就會排在前面,如果首字母相同,可以以名字的第二個字母排列,依次類推。
根據其中另一個示例,所述通訊錄分類單元還用于:根據移動終端接收到信息的時間進行排序;
所述通訊源分類單元還用于:根據移動終端接收到信息的時間進行排序;
所述字符串分類單元還用于:根據移動終端接收到信息的時間進行排序。
這樣就可以讓用戶了解到最新的信息,也方便用戶查到需要了解的信息。
根據其中另一個示例,所述信息數量分類單元還用于:根據通訊方的信息數量進行排序,若通訊方的信息數量相同,則按照通訊方的姓名中的首字母進行排序。
這樣就更加方便用戶查找信息。例如,收到張三的信息為50條,收到李四的信息為80條,收到王五的信息為50條,那么首先就會根據收到信息的條數的多少進行排序,李四拍在第一位,但是由于收到張三和王五的信息數量相同,那么就應該根據張三和王五的首字母順序進行排列,一般都是根據英語字母表中的順序進行排序,這時由于字母W在字母Z的前面,因此王五的信息就會排在張三的前面顯示,這樣也符合用戶的使用習慣,方便用戶使用。
以上內容是結合具體的優選實施方式對本發明所作的進一步詳細說明,不能認定本發明的具體實施只局限于這些說明。對于本發明所屬技術領域的普通技術人員來說,在不脫離本發明構思的前提下,還可以做出若干簡單推演或替換,都應當視為屬于本發明的保護范圍。